Samuel Vail 1754 – 1846 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 23 Aug 1754

Birth Location: Greenbrook, Somerset, New Jersey, USA

Death Date: 12 Apr 1846

Death Location: Middletown, Butler, Ohio, USA

Father: Stephen Vail

Mother: Esther Smith

Spouse(s): Deziah Jennings

Children(s): Isaac Vail

Samuel Vail was born in 1754 in Greenbrook, Somerset, New Jersey, USA, the child of Stephen Vail and Esther Smith. Samuel Vail married Deziah Jennings, and had children including Isaac M. Vail. Samuel Vail passed away in 1846 in Middletown, Butler, Ohio, USA.
